Output 16db472bf99a5eccab310d33d8bb5578349eaecd70be250fba9d3c8b55d2384e:6

value
2000000
script pubkey
OP_0 OP_PUSHBYTES_20 c628897c300a1a87c5af827fc71e2573244b76a6
address
bc1qcc5gjlpspgdg03d0sfluw839wvjyka4xjmjepz
transaction
16db472bf99a5eccab310d33d8bb5578349eaecd70be250fba9d3c8b55d2384e
confirmations
177225
spent
true